Ariba Has Been a Trusted Cloud Provider Since 1999

• 1999: Ariba Network built a multi-tenant, On-Demand application delivered in the Cloud.

• 2005: Ariba moved Sourcing, Contracts, and Spend Visibility applications to the Cloud.

• 2006: Ariba moved Procurement and Invoicing applications to

the Cloud.• Today: Over 340,000 organizations conduct business in the

Ariba Cloud.

Ariba’s Cloud InnovationsReliability and Availability Reliability and Availability

Top Notch Infrastructure with Redundancy throughout the System• Redundant servers at all layers• Fully Populated Disaster Recovery Site with up-to-the-minute replication• Network and appliance redundancyMonitored and Available• 100k+ monitored metrics• 24/7/365 coverage – no standing maintenance window• Application performance monitoring• Customer experience monitoring (outside-in)

Ariba’s Cloud Innovations

Physical Security• Top notch datacenter• Hand-scan access• Access list is audited

twice/year

Network Security• Industry standard firewalls • Strict change control process• IDS

Certifications and Assurances• PCI certified each year• Webtrust audit every six months• SAS70 Type II every six months

Application Security• Dedicated security team• Developers trained in best practices• Frequent penetration tests and security scans• Highly skilled industry experts

World-Class SecurityWorld-Class Security

Ariba’s Cloud Innovations

Visibility into Critical Business ProcessesVisibility into Critical Business Processes

Key Components• Define the warning/critical metrics of the

end-to-end business process• Detect that the business process has met

or exceeded one of these levels• Notify the necessary resources that a

business process is in jeopardy• Provide enough information to the

resources so that they can take action to remedy the issue

Sample Business Processes• Purchase Order: Buyer to Supplier• Invoice: Supplier to Buyer• OK-to-pay file: AN to ERP or bank• End of quarter reports

Companies are entrusting critical business processes to Ariba’s Cloud. We have learned that this requires us to collaborate with IT departments to ensure those business processes are successful.
